W: Exercise, exercise, exercise! We hear so much about it these days that even the experts can’t agree on which exercises are best. Now some doctors are strongly encouraging arm exercises.
M: Arm exercises? I’ve never heard of that. Is that because our arms are too fat or flabby?
W: Actually, that’s not the main reason. They say that arm exercises are an ideal way to become physically fit.
M: But don’t arm exercises raise your blood pressure? Seems I’ve read an article about that before. So, that’s risky.
W: Not really. That they do, but the article I read mentioned several ways that can compensate for that.
M: Really? How?
W: By adding leg exercise so the arms don’t do all the work. Arm exercises alone aren’t enough to increase metabolism before fatigue sets in. The more ot a body that involves in the exercise the better.
M: And in turn, I’m sure that there is a great chance of losing weight, right?
W: Sounds right to me.
M: So, what exercises do the experts recommend?
W: They mentioned quite a few. But some of the more popular ones are cycling with special bicycles that make you use both your arms and legs, and walking vigorously while wearing arm weights.
M: Sounds great. I must try that. You know, I like to walk a lot.
